Tamkor - Malsisar, Jhunjhunu

Tamkor is a village situated in the Malsisar tehsil of Jhunjhunu district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 47 km from Jhunjhunun and around 47 km from Jhunjhunun. Tamkor village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Tamkor is 070853. The village covers a total geographical area of 1490 hectares and falls under the 331026 pincode. Jhunjhunun is the nearest town, located about 47 km away.

Tamkor village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Mandawa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jhunjhunu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Tamkor

As per Census 2011, Tamkor village has a total population of 5,782 people, consisting of 2,869 males and 2,913 females. The village has 1,070 households and a sex ratio of 1,015 females per 1,000 males. There are 828 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 3,247 literate and 2,535 illiterate residents. Additionally, 897 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 44 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Tamkor

Tamkor is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Dudhwakhara, while the nearest airport is Hissar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 81.1 km.
